Stephanie Dianne Hartwell – The Charley Project
- Missing Since11/28/2001
- Missing FromColumbia, Mississippi
- ClassificationEndangered Missing
- Date of Birth08/16/1976 (42)
- Age25 years old
- Height and Weight5'5, 145 - 150 pounds
- Distinguishing CharacteristicsAfrican-American female. Black hair, black eyes. Hartwell has a small scar below her right eye. She has several tattoos: the initials R.J.J.T. on her outer right forearm; a butterfly on her right bicep; the name "Steph" on her left bicep; and a heart with three to four drops below it on her left thigh. Her ears are pierced.
Hartwell was last seen between 8:30 and 9:00 a.m on November 28, 2001, getting into a green four-door Saturn with tinted windows in the vicinity of Harrison-Jefferson Road in Columbia, Mississippi. She has not been seen or heard from since. She left behind three children, whom she walked to the school bus stop shortly before she vanished.
After Hartwell's disappearance, investigators found her purse. Nothing appeared to be missing from it. An extensive search failed to turn up any clue as to Hartwell's whereabouts. Her case is unsolved; the circumstances surrounding her disappearance are unclear.
